Tim Mee Galaxy Laser Team


I picked up this bag of throwback Tim Mee Galaxy Laser Team figures last summer on eBay for cheap, just for fun- my childhood friend had the pink, green, black and white original assortment back in the '70s. From a quick internet search, it appears these were also released as Galaxy Laser Team with Space Monsters and just Star Patrol as well, often an included "X-Wing Rocket" advertised on the packaging, my contemporary set here including two that came in two pieces that snap together. Decals for the ships, but I chose not to apply them.

Tim Mee Toy Soldiers


I've been on the lookout for some fun green Army Men to use in my toy photography, and have seen some pretty impressive deluxe sets out and about as well as online, but wasn't seeing exactly what I was looking for. Bubba over at Toyriffic reminded me just exactly what that was recently- the toy soldiers of our youth, produced by Tim Mee. Revived by J.Lloyd International c.2011, these plastic army men are the same Vietnam era sculpts I remembered from childhood, updated in two shades of punchy green- just what I was looking for!
